Instead of imagining X3 pilots in a WWII era cockpit, imagine them in the futuristic version - it has no windows, and is completely encased to protect the pilot from the massive G forces experienced in dogfights, or there are so many interconnections to your brain necessary to run a bigger ship that there's no room for windows anyways. In fact, it's been that way all along, even in X and X2 - but just as RL operating systems have moved further and further away from command line driven interfaces, so to have modern X-tech cockpit pods moved away from the more primitive representation style of old-school cockpits. They're there if you want'em (Cockpit mods) but are no longer bundled software. In terms of 'believability': Jump[gates|drives] break every known law of physics, a neural interface is merely beyond our present computing power.
Suspension of disbelief is all about the ability to rationalize in a fun way. That's the way I see it anyways. I never let fluff get in the way of a good game. There's always counter-fluff to mitigate any worries that might crop up.
